Obtaining a French Driving License: A Comprehensive Guide

Obtaining a driving license in France can be a difficult procedure for both homeowners and migrants. France needs that chauffeurs follow specific legal and practical requirements, guaranteeing a smooth shift into the French driving system. This post supplies a thorough overview of the actions associated with obtaining a French driving license, including possible mistakes and regularly asked questions.

Overview of French Driving License Categories

France issues several classifications of driving licenses, which represent different kinds of cars. The primary classifications include:

CategoryDescription
BAutomobiles (approximately 3.5 loads, and can carry as much as 8 guests)
ABikes (various subclasses depending on engine size)
CTrucks (over 3.5 heaps)
DBuses (for carrying 9 or more travelers)
BETrailers (over 750 kg)

Understanding these classifications is vital, as the type you need will dictate the requirements and training included in obtaining your license.

Eligibility Requirements

To obtain a French driving license, applicants need to fulfill particular eligibility requirements:

  1. Age: Applicants should be at least 18 years old for a classification B license. Age requirements differ for other categories.
  2. Residency: Applicants need to be legal residents of France and registered with the regional authorities.
  3. Health: A medical checkup may be required, particularly for particular categories such as C and D.
  4. Driving School: Enrollment in a recognized driving school is generally necessary, although exemptions can use.

Actions to Obtain a French Driving License

1. Choose the Right Driving School

Discovering a qualified driving school is essential. The school should be authorized by the French federal government to guarantee that it follows the legal instructional curriculum.

  • Look For Local Schools: Use online resources and word of mouth.
  • Inspect Credentials: Ensure the school has authorization (a "label de qualité") from the government.
  • Speak with Reviews: Look for reviews from former trainees.

2. Register and Pay Fees

When a school is chosen, enlist in a driving course. Fees can vary significantly based on the area and school's credibility.

3. Total Theory Lessons

Before taking the driving test, prospects need to finish a series of theory lessons covering roadway rules, signs, and safety regulations.

  • Make Use Of Study Aids: Engage with research study materials and online resources.
  • Mock Tests: Practice with mock exams to assess readiness.

4. Pass the Theory Exam

The theory examination includes 40 multiple-choice questions, with a passing score of at least 35 right answers. A failure can indicate retaking classes and rescheduling the test.

5. Practical Lessons

After passing the theory test, students start practical driving lessons. Depending on specific skills, trainees might require anywhere from 20 to 40 hours of behind-the-wheel guideline.

6. Pass the Practical Driving Test

The dry run consists of an assessment of driving skills performed by a main examiner.

  • Demonstrate Skills: Applicants need to show proficiency in different driving scenarios, consisting of parking, turning, and following traffic signals.
  • Get Ready For Possible Re-tests: If not successful, prospects will normally need to take extra lessons before reapplying for the test.

Obtaining a License From Another Country

For those who hold a driving license from another EU nation, the process is less complex. Those with licenses from non-EU nations may deal with extra difficulties, consisting of obligatory tests.

  • EU License Holders: Usually just need to exchange their license for a French one, which usually involves presenting kinds of ID and proof of residency.
  • Non-EU License Holders: Often should take both theoretical and useful tests, depending on mutual arrangements in between France and the providing country.

Costs Involved

The overall cost of obtaining a French driving license can differ extensively, including tuition charges at driving schools, assessment costs, and administrative expenses.

Expenditure TypeEstimated Cost (EUR)
Driving School Fees1,200 - 2,000
Theory Exam Fee30 - 50
Dry Run Fee100 - 200
Medical Exam Fee50 - 150
Overall1,400 - 2,400

Typical Challenges

While the procedure might seem straightforward, there are numerous challenges applicants may encounter:

  • Language Barrier: Non-French speakers might battle with language during both tests, although there are options for taking exams in other languages.
  • Navigating Paperwork: Ensuring all documents are in order can be cumbersome.
  • Scheduling Delays: High need can lead to long waiting durations for tests.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

What if I fail the driving test?

If you stop working, you can retake the exam. Nevertheless, it's suggested to have refresher lessons before attempting once again.

Can I drive in France with a non-EU license?

Typically yes, for up to a year. After this period, acheter permis français you will need to either convert your license or obtain a brand-new one in France.

Do I require to take a medical examination?

Generally, yes, especially for larger vehicle classifications (C and D), though a standard health check is not necessary for category B.

Is insurance coverage essential?

Yes, having automobile insurance coverage is obligatory in France and should be obtained before driving.

For how long does it take to get a French driving license?

It can take anywhere from a few months to over a year, depending on private preparedness and school availability.

Obtaining a French driving license involves navigating a systematic process that requires preparation and diligence. Comprehending the various steps, expenses, and challenges can equip prospects with the knowledge they require to be successful. With extensive preparation, aiming chauffeurs can confidently protect their licenses and accept the liberty of driving in France.
